In recent years, the intersection of technology and culinary arts has led to groundbreaking innovations in kitchen robotics. These advancements have the potential to revolutionize the way we cook, eat, and interact with food in our daily lives. One key factor driving this innovation is government-funded programs that support research and development in the field of kitchen robotics. Government-funded programs play a crucial role in fostering technological advancements by providing funding, resources, and support to researchers and companies working on cutting-edge projects. In the realm of kitchen robotics, these programs have enabled scientists and engineers to explore new possibilities and push the boundaries of what is possible in the kitchen. One example of a government-funded program that has made a significant impact in the field of kitchen robotics is the European Commission's Horizon 2020 initiative. This program has provided funding for research projects focused on developing advanced robotics technologies for various industries, including food and hospitality. Through this initiative, researchers have been able to create innovative kitchen robots that can assist with food preparation, cooking, and cleaning tasks. Another notable government-funded program is the National Robotics Initiative in the United States, which supports research projects aimed at advancing the field of robotics across different sectors. Through this program, scientists and engineers have been able to develop robotic systems that can automate cooking processes, optimize ingredient storage, and enhance food safety in commercial kitchens.
